Ophthalmic Eye Dropper Market: How Is Preservative-Free Multidose Delivery Becoming the Fastest-Growing Formulation Innovation?
Preservative-free multidose eye dropper delivery — the advanced bottle and dispensing systems enabling multiple-use administration without benzalkonium chloride (BAK) or other preservatives, reducing ocular surface toxicity while maintaining sterility and dosing accuracy representing the fastest-growing formulation innovation in the global ophthalmic eye dropper market — creates the most ocular-surface-friendly market segment, with the Ophthalmic Eye Dropper Market reflecting preservative-free multidose delivery as the premium growth ocular-surface-friendly driver.
BAK toxicity and dry eye disease awareness — the growing recognition that chronic BAK exposure contributes to tear film instability, corneal epitheliopathy, and medication-induced dry eye in 30-50% of long-term glaucoma patients, driving patient and prescriber demand for preservative-free alternatives — demonstrates the safety commercial impact. Preservative-free multidose systems now capturing approximately thirty-five percent of new glaucoma and dry eye product launches, with Thea Pharmaceuticals (ABAK bottle), Ursapharm (COMOD system), and Aptar (Ophthalmic Squeeze Dispenser) leading platform technologies, while single-use vials persist for acute and perioperative applications.
COMOD and ABAK filter-based sterile delivery — the mechanical filtration systems (0.2 micron bacterial filter, one-way valve, silver-ion antimicrobial surfaces) maintaining sterility for 3-6 months after opening without chemical preservatives, with drop size control (25-35 µL) reducing systemic absorption and side effects — demonstrates the engineering innovation driving adoption. These systems' ability to deliver 200-300 drops per bottle with <5% contamination rate in clinical studies creating the safety differentiation from traditional multidose bottles requiring preservatives, with European markets leading adoption and US FDA increasingly receptive to preservative-free claims.
Connected and smart eye dropper devices — the integration of Bluetooth-enabled caps, dose tracking, and adherence monitoring (Eyedrop, AARDEX, Propeller Health) into ophthalmic bottles for glaucoma and age-related macular degeneration patients requiring strict compliance — creating the digital health expansion beyond physical delivery. Connected droppers now representing approximately eight to twelve percent of premium eye dropper value, with pharmaceutical companies (Allergan/AbbVie, Novartis, Santen) evaluating smart packaging for clinical trial adherence and real-world evidence generation.

FAQ
What ophthalmic eye dropper systems and preservative-free technologies are available? Leading eye dropper systems: Preservative-free multidose: ABAK (Thea — polymer membrane filter, 0.2 micron); COMOD (Ursapharm — airless pump, one-way valve); OSD (Aptar — Ophthalmic Squeeze Dispenser, precise drop); Novelia (Laboratoires Thea — soft-touch bottle); iDose (Glaukos — travoprost implant, not dropper); Traditional multidose: Standard LDPE bottle with BAK (0.004-0.02%); Polyquad (polyquaternium-1 — less toxic preservative); Purite (stabilized oxychloro complex — dissipates); Sodium perborate; Single-use: Unit-dose vials (preservative-free, 0.2-0.5 mL); Strip packaging; Key specifications: Drop size (25-50 µL standard; smaller = less systemic absorption); Sterility (USP <71>); Preservative type and concentration; Bottle material (LDPE, HDPE, PP); Tip design (soft, standard); Closure integrity; Shelf life (2-5 years); In-use period (28 days standard; 3-6 months preservative-free); Dosing accuracy (±10%); Patient ergonomics (squeeze force, grip).
What is the typical cost and market dynamics for ophthalmic eye droppers? Eye dropper economics: Standard preserved bottle: $0.50-2.00 (manufacturing); $5-15 (retail generic); Preservative-free multidose: $3-8 (manufacturing premium); $15-40 (retail branded); Single-use unit dose: $0.30-1.00 per vial; $30-100 per month (chronic use); Connected/smart dropper: $20-50 (device premium); $50-150 (retail); Bottle manufacturing: Blow-fill-seal (BFS): $0.10-0.30 per bottle; Form-fill-seal: $0.20-0.50; Contract manufacturing: $0.50-3.00 per bottle (depending on complexity); Market size: $1.5-2 billion global (ophthalmic packaging); Growth: 6-8% annually; Drivers: Dry eye epidemic, glaucoma prevalence, preservative-free demand, regulatory pressure on BAK, patient compliance, generic competition; Challenges: Cost premium, manufacturing complexity, sterility validation, shelf life, patient education, reimbursement (no separate dropper reimbursement).
